Took my Toyota into the shop today because it had been whining on cold start. Turns out my power steering rack / gear assembly had been leaking fluid.
The dealership quoted me $2250 to replace the assembly, add new fluid, replace a belt, and align my tires. I told him it was too much and he offered to delay replacing the belt and quoted me $1950. Then I asked if there was any sort of discount he could apply and he got me to $1750. Still hurts but $500 in savings is not bad. Serves as a good reminder that you can always ask for a discount, especially on big purchases.
